Determining the precise point about which an aircraft would balance is a critical aspect of flight safety and performance. This point, often expressed in inches from a defined datum, directly impacts the aircraft’s stability and control characteristics. Its calculation involves accounting for the weight and location of all items aboard, including the aircraft itself, passengers, fuel, and cargo. An example calculation requires summing the moments (weight multiplied by arm) of all items, then dividing that total by the total weight of the aircraft to arrive at the point of balance.

Maintaining this point within established limits ensures predictable handling and prevents conditions that could lead to instability or control loss. Historically, incorrect calculations, or exceeding limitations, has been a contributing factor in accidents. Precise determination allows for optimized performance by minimizing drag and maximizing lift. The weight and balance considerations are essential to flight safety, impacting every phase of flight from takeoff to landing.

The conversion between the number of molecules of a substance and its mass in grams is a fundamental calculation in chemistry. It allows for the quantitative analysis of chemical reactions and compositions. The process hinges on the use of Avogadro’s number (approximately 6.022 x 1023 molecules/mol) and the molar mass of the substance.

This type of conversion is crucial for accurate experimentation and the scaling up of chemical processes. Understanding the relationship between molecular quantity and mass enables precise measurements in research and industrial settings, preventing waste and ensuring desired outcomes. Its roots lie in the development of the mole concept, which standardized the way chemists relate microscopic quantities to macroscopic measurements.

The procedure quantifies the amount of usable lumber that can be derived from a raw log. This calculation is typically expressed using a measurement system based on nominal dimensions of one inch thick, one foot wide, and one foot long. Such a system provides a standardized method for estimating the yield from timber resources prior to processing. For instance, a log that is calculated to contain 100 units represents the potential for producing 100 pieces of lumber with those defined dimensions.

Accurate timber volume estimation is crucial for various stakeholders within the forestry and lumber industries. It allows for efficient resource management, fair pricing during timber sales, and optimized milling operations. Historically, estimating lumber yield required manual measurements and application of complex formulas. Modern tools streamline this process, offering increased accuracy and reducing the potential for human error. This promotes economic stability within related sectors.
